Sept. 20, 2013: Schneider Electric Adopts AutoGrid for its Home Management System
System Will Give Homeowners a Closer Connection to Their Energy Information
PALO ALTO, Calif. — Schneider Electric, a leader in energy management, and AutoGrid Systems, a leader in big data analytics for the electricity and energy industry, have announced a partnership to bring demand response and big data analytics services to utilities, service providers, and consumers in North America.
Under the partnership, Schneider Electric will integrate AutoGrid’s Energy Data Platform (EDP), a cloud-based big data platform for managing and optimizing the electricity grid, into its Wiser™ Home Management System, a home energy management system designed to connect utilities and consumers, enabling homeowners to better control energy consumption. According to the companies, Wiser Powered by AutoGrid will allow utilities to reduce peak power, curb emissions, and improve energy productivity to effectively utilize more of the electricity that is generated on the grid by enabling users to have a closer connection to their energy information.
